Transaction 684ef9a7a42a169920823d41ab61bd1881b6b38de11ef3c8bdeabff68f5b75c6
1 Input
1 Output
-
684ef9a7a42a169920823d41ab61bd1881b6b38de11ef3c8bdeabff68f5b75c6:0
- value
- 1865000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bda621cb24f8485a356aed56e9fd0fec4bc7f660 OP_EQUAL
- address
- 3JynerUaa8UgxaJcJC534HgHjCmC4Pvbrz